Уважаемые дамы и господа! Для вас сохранен старый форум по адресу http://forum.intersyst.ru

Страницы: 1 2 След.
RSS
Не загружается GD2, DHS3bin/......failed
 
Доброго времени! подскажите, станция R8, вдруг пропала внешняя связь по IP, перезагрузили и видим, что шлюз GD2 не загрузился. Пишет: Downloading/DHS3bin/downbin/....failed.
На станции етот файл есть. Проверку БД сделали. Сам шлюз пингуется, параметры IP норм.
Куда копать?
 
Проверять IP параметры. Смотреть - что в менеджменте shelf/board/Ethernet param - указан МАС адрес GD. Смотреть инциденты на процессоре. Смотреть - как у вас сеть организована (может чего-то из протоколов на сети прикрыли).
 
В менеджменте shelf/board/Ethernet param - есть МАС, но нет адреса, маски и шлюза, это так и должно быть?
 
Да, нужен МАС. Все остальное появится, когда плата прогрузится.
А с инцидентами на процессоре - что?
Изменения (работы) на сети были (в праздники что-то кто-то сделал)?
 
вариантов много

1-ый
Цитата
Михаил пишет:
На станции етот файл есть.
не факт, тобишь может только название от файла есть
смотрите smartctrl

2-ой
плате GD - кранты
надо вставать консолью на GD и смотреть тараканов
если другие GD загружаются значит действительно кранты, либо на половину

3-ый
IP-адреса совпадают с кем-то
arp -a
по IP от GD должен показать  00:80:хх:хх:хх:хх

и т.д. так далее по остальным вариантам
Пути IP-пакета неисповедимы
 
Вначале у нас перестала работать внешняя связь, по IP-каналу. Внутренняя работала. После проверки решили перезагрузить станцию, тут всё и получили.
Проблемы с сетью пока исключаем, т.к. оба ЛАН-интерфейса (CS и DG2) включены в свич платы CS. От локалки отключили. Все платы на станции - out of service, кроме CS. Завтра проверим жесткий диск и подготовим тестовую подмену GD.
Может дело в жестком, файл бинарника посмотрели, по размеру и виду аналогичен подобному на другой станции. Командами линукса копируется и перезаписывается без проблем, а GD его никак не может взять.
 
Жесткий диск проверили, битых секторов нет, логические ошибки были, e2fsck их исправил, далее процессор грузится без проблем. Заходим на GD консолью, смотрим что пишет при загрузке, опять видим, что не может стянуть файл binmg с CS по tftp.

binmg : this is Media Gateway Software R8.0 for E-MGD version 43.15.2 built on 28 May 08 17 hours 17 min for r_mg_appli_43.15.2              
Downloading /DHS3bin/downbin/emg/binmg from хх.хх.хх.хх
/usr/bin/binmg_download: download_binary binmg failed
Причем по ftp с GD на CS доступ есть, сетка в порядке. По TFTP доступа нет.

Смотрю на CS через PS -A |grep ftp - ответ пустой, значит tftp нет. Смотрю аналогично на другой АТС, пишет что данный сервис есть. Делаем вывод, что он не грузится на CS.
Запускаем его на CS ручками под рутом - /DHS3bin/servers/tftpd
далее запускаем с GD команду под рутом '/usr/bin/download_binary binmg'- все проходит на ура и файл появляется в /tmp/ с размером 990 байт - все как положено.

Осталось выяснить почему tftp  сервер не грузится демоном при запуске CS.
Выясняем что грузится он через xinetd.
Смотрим конфиг /etc/xintetd.d/tftp и видим, что там он выключен, т.е. disable=yes, принудительно меняю через vi его на no, перегружаю, смотрю, он опять стоит в yes, т.е. отключен.

куда копать дальше?
 
какими-то вы хитрыми путями идете... на работающем CS дайте команду netstat -a - слушает ли он tftp порт?
в каком режиме стартует у вас GD - статический адрес или динамический? если статический - в процессе загрузки мелькает настройка GD - адрес, нетмаска, откуда грузится, номер полки и т.п. - эти настройки у вас не слетели? (смотреть в консольном порту GD)
У Дарта Вейдера в столе всякого навалено: карты разные галактик и портрет Гагарина.
 
(1)ygl_27> netstat -a
Active Internet connections (servers and established)
Proto Recv-Q Send-Q Local Address           Foreign Address         State
tcp        0      0 *:shell                 *:*                     LISTEN
tcp        0      0 *:nmccs                 *:*                     LISTEN
tcp        0      0 *:servobs               *:*                     LISTEN
tcp        0      0 *:netaccess             *:*                     LISTEN
tcp        0      0 *:cmisd                 *:*                     LISTEN
tcp        0      0 127.0.0.1:netadmin      *:*                     LISTEN
tcp        0      0 *:builddistant          *:*                     LISTEN
tcp        0      0 *:loaddistant           *:*                     LISTEN
tcp        0      0 *:www                   *:*                     LISTEN
tcp        0      0 *:suprout               *:*                     LISTEN
tcp        0      0 *:ftp                   *:*                     LISTEN
tcp        0      0 *:telnet                *:*                     LISTEN
tcp        0      0 *:rcsta                 *:*                     LISTEN
tcp        0      0 *:https                 *:*                     LISTEN
tcp        0      0 127.0.0.1:10001         127.0.0.1:cmisd         ESTABLISHED
tcp        0      0 127.0.0.1:10002         127.0.0.1:10003         ESTABLISHED
tcp        0      0 127.0.0.1:10003         127.0.0.1:10002         ESTABLISHED
tcp        0      0 127.0.0.1:cmisd         127.0.0.1:10001         ESTABLISHED
udp        0      0 yglish_27:32640         *:*
udp        0      0 *:syslog                *:*
udp        0      0 127.0.0.1:dhcdupli_m    *:*
udp        0      0 *:prslink               *:*
udp        0      0 *:incid2trap            *:*
udp        0      0 *:9743                  *:*
udp        0      0 *:snmp                  *:*
udp        0      0 *:bootps                *:*
udp        0      0 *:bootps                *:*
udp        0      0 *:tftp                  *:*
udp        0      0 *:tftp                  *:*
udp        0      0 yglish_27:ntp           *:*
udp        0      0 127.0.0.1:ntp           *:*
udp        0      0 *:ntp                   *:*
udp        0      0 *:hybrid-vpn            *:*
Active UNIX domain sockets (servers and established)
Proto RefCnt Flags       Type       State         I-Node Path
unix  12     [ ] DGRAM 1358 /dev/log
unix  2      [ ] DGRAM 12687
unix  2      [ ] DGRAM 12659
unix  2      [ ] DGRAM 9196
unix  2      [ ] DGRAM 9166
unix  2      [ ] DGRAM 5048
unix  2      [ ] DGRAM 5044
unix  2      [ ] DGRAM 2453
unix  2      [ ] DGRAM 1957
unix  2      [ ] DGRAM 1500
unix  2      [ ] DGRAM 1491
unix  2      [ ] STREAM CONNECTED 677

Стартует GD статикой, сетевые настройки видно, все стоит как нужно.
Изменено: Михаил - 14.05.2014 11:21:29
 
список netstat похож на нормальный, не понятно только почему tftp два раза... есть еще вариант потери файла lanpbx.cfg. восстановить его содержимое просто командой lanpbxbuild и далее заполнить нужные строчки, после - сохранить. подробнее - в доке.
У Дарта Вейдера в столе всякого навалено: карты разные галактик и портрет Гагарина.
 
lanpbxbuild при просмотре параметров показал адрес процессора и tftp сервера отличный от требуемого, т.е. если наш находится в хх.хх.111.хх сети, то там почему-то был задан хх.хх.11.хх вот такой адрес, но после внесения изменений и перезагрузки станции ситуация не поменялась:
Downloading /DHS3bin/downbin/emg/binmg from хх.хх.111.хх
/usr/bin/binmg_download: download_binary binmg failed
/usr/bin/binmg_download: too many retries, giving up
binmg download failed after 3 retries

ну и ничего не поднялось.
В итоге, потому как тянуть с вводом АТС уже нельзя, взяли другой жесткий диск, на него накатили через pc-installer систему, восстановили базу и лицензию и включили АТС, все заработало. Старый диск оставили, чтобы потом собрать тестовую станцию и на ней эту проблему до конца вылечить.
 
сильно похоже, что на станции сперва что-то где-то работало, потом сменили IP адреса, но как водится не везде или не в нужном порядке. думаю, если вы на старом ПО сделаете полноценный netadmin, затем lanpbxbuild затем mgconfig на GD у вас все нормально стартует.

Вы то пишете, что релиз 8 работал и перестал, то в конце - вводите новую станцию - речь шла об одной и той же АТС?
У Дарта Вейдера в столе всякого навалено: карты разные галактик и портрет Гагарина.
 
Если вы меняли IP параметры - то в lanpbx оно само не поменяется.
Второе - после смены параметров через lanpbxbuild - мне помнится, что параметры в tftp демоне на лету не поменяются - требуется рестарт станции.
 
Цитата
Dmitry Ryzhakov пишет:
Вы то пишете, что релиз 8 работал и перестал, то в конце - вводите новую станцию - речь шла об одной и той же АТС?
Да, станция одна. Была станция, стояла себе спокойно несколько лет, ее никто не трогал, в один прекрасный воскресный день она частично перестала работать, после удаленной перезагрузки перестало работать все.
Далее три дня ковыряния привели только к тому, что АТС поднималась вручную, поэтому было принято решение взять новый жесткий диск и залить на него 8й релиз с патчем и далее базу и лицензии с этой глючной станции. А старый диск оставили для дальнейших разбирательств, когда появится подопытная АТС. После заливки все поднялось, поэтому поставили ее на прежнее место.
 
Цитата
vad пишет:
Если вы меняли IP параметры - то в lanpbx оно само не поменяется.

Второе - после смены параметров через lanpbxbuild - мне помнится, что параметры в tftp демоне на лету не поменяются - требуется рестарт станции.
После смены параметров через lanpbxbuild и рестарта станции она не поднялась. Дальше времени экспериментировать уже, к сожалению, не было.
Изменено: Михаил - 15.05.2014 17:14:16
Страницы: 1 2 След.
Читают тему